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K was filed by Concierge Technologies, Inc. (not Marygold Companies, Inc.) on July 1, 2020, with a signature date of July 6, 2020. The report details the completion of an asset acquisition by the company's wholly owned subsidiary, Gourmet Foods Limited.
Key Financial Metrics and Transaction Details
- Acquisition Target: Printstock Products Limited, a printing business in New Zealand.
- Purchase Price: NZ$1,900,000 (approximately US$1,200,000) in cash.
- Financing Structure: Concierge Technologies provided a loan to Gourmet Foods of NZ$1,110,000 (approximately US$700,000) to fund the purchase price.
- Loan Terms: 0% interest rate with no maturity date.
- Ownership Status: Gourmet Foods became the sole shareholder of Printstock upon closing.
Material Changes
The primary material change is the expansion of the company's operations into the printing sector through the acquisition of Printstock Products Limited. This transaction was originally agreed upon in March 2020 and formally closed on July 1, 2020, satisfying all conditions set forth in the Agreement.
Outlook, Risks, and Management Commentary
Management confirmed that all closing conditions were satisfied. The filing references a press release issued on July 6, 2020, regarding the closing. The filing does not provide specific forward-looking guidance, revenue projections, or detailed risk factors beyond the standard incorporation of the purchase agreement. The creation of a direct financial obligation (the intercompany loan) is noted under Item 2.03.
